Circular window installation services involve fitting round-shaped windows into existing or new building structures. This process typically includes measuring the opening, selecting the appropriate window style, and securely installing the window to ensure proper fit and function. Service providers may also handle finishing touches such as sealing and trimming to create a polished appearance. The goal is to enhance the aesthetic appeal of a property while ensuring the window operates correctly and remains durable over time.
These services are often sought to address specific problems or design goals. For example, homeowners may want to replace outdated or damaged round windows that no longer seal properly or have become a source of drafts and leaks. Circular windows can also be added to improve natural light entry or to create a distinctive architectural feature. By choosing professional installation, property owners can avoid issues like improper sealing, which can lead to water intrusion, or structural damage caused by incorrect fitting.
Circular window installation is common in various types of properties, including residential homes, historic buildings, and commercial spaces. Many older houses feature rounded window openings that may need updating or restoring. Modern homes might incorporate circular windows for decorative purposes or to maximize light in specific rooms like bathrooms, stairwells, or attics. Commercial properties, such as boutique shops or office buildings, may also use circular windows to add visual interest or create a unique facade.

The overview below groups typical Circular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Billings, MT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or circular window repairs or repl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on window size and material.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Standard Installation - For replacing existing circular windows with standard sizes, local contractors often charge between $800 and $2,500. Most projects land in this range, with larger or more complex installations occasionally exceeding $3,000.
Full Replacement - Complete removal and installation of new circular windows can cost from $2,500 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ects, such as custom shapes or specialty glass, tend to push costs toward the higher end.
Custom or Specialty Projects - Custom-shaped or specialty glass circular windows typically start around $3,000 and can reach $7,000+ for elaborate designs. These projects are less common and often represent the top tier of typical costs for local pros.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
